A demand letter sample for money owed is a written communication addressed to an individual or business who owes a debt or payment. It serves as a formal notice demanding the immediate settlement of the outstanding amount. This document outlines the specific details of the debt, including its origin, amount owed, and any supporting documentation. Simple Demand Letter Sample for Money Owed: A simple demand letter sample for money owed is a concise and straightforward document stating the owed amount, the purpose of the debt, and a demand for immediate payment. It may include a suggested deadline for settlement and contact information for further communication. 2. Serious Demand Letter Sample for Money Owed: A serious demand letter sample is more assertive in tone and may be used when previous attempts to collect the debt have failed. It emphasizes the consequences of non-compliance, such as legal action or reporting the debtor to credit bureaus, to urge prompt payment. 3. Formal Demand Letter Sample for Money Owed: A formal demand letter sample for money owed is suitable for business-to-business transactions or when dealing with a professional entity. This type of letter adheres to strict business correspondence etiquette and may include a reference to applicable laws or contractual agreements. 4. Legal Demand Letter Sample for Money Owed: A legal demand letter sample for money owed is often written by an attorney on behalf of a creditor. It typically emphasizes the legal implications of non-payment, preparing the debtor for possible legal action such as a lawsuit or filing a claim. 5. Final Demand Letter Sample for Money Owed: A final demand letter sample is used after previous attempts to collect the debt have failed. It explicitly states that the letter is the final opportunity to settle the outstanding amount before taking legal action. It may include an increase in the demanded payment due to additional expenses incurred during the collection process.
